一、准备文件
mysql-5.6.36-linux-glibc2.5-x86_64.tar.gz
官网下载链接
二、解压
1
| $ tar mysql-5.6.36-linux-glibc2.5-x86_64.tar.gz
|
三、MySQL安装
1、进入mysql的安装路径
1 2
| $ cd mysql-5.6.36-linux-glibc2.5-x86_64/ $ mkdir datadir
|
2、复制默认配置文件
1
| $ cp support-files/my-default.cnf ./my.cnf
|
3、修改配置文件my.cnf
1 2 3 4 5
| basedir = /home/sun_zeming/mysql/mysql-5.6.36-linux-glibc2.5-x86_64 datadir = /home/sun_zeming/mysql/mysql-5.6.36-linux-glibc2.5-x86_64/datadir port = 6660 # server_id = ..... socket = /home/sun_zeming/mysql/mysql-5.6.36-linux-glibc2.5-x86_64/mysql.sock
|
4、安装mysql
1
| $ ./scripts/mysql_install_db --user=root --defaults-file=/home/sun_zeming/mysql/mysql-5.6.36-linux-glibc2.5-x86_64/my.cnf
|
四、启动MySQL
1
| $ ./bin/mysqld --defaults-file=/home/sun_zeming/mysql/mysql-5.6.36-linux-glibc2.5-x86_64/my.cnf
|
五、MySQL授权
1、设置root用户密码
1
| $ ./bin/mysqladmin –h127.0.0.1 –P6660 -u root password "123456"
|
2、登录mysql
1
| $ ./bin/mysql –h127.0.0.1 -P6660 -uroot -p123456
|
3、授权
1
| mysql> grant all privileges on *.* to 'root'@'%' identified by '123456' with grant option;
|